May the Force Be with Your Marketing Team

Our conversation hadn’t slowed a bit, but we had stopped getting our drinks refilled and it was nearly time to head home from our happy hour (nearly three hours) when one of the company owners commented about the success of the team. When I reminded him he never thought we’d have a marketing team, he said our CXO played a Jedi mind trick on him to build one.

So there you have it. If you want an outstanding marketing team and you’re a small business, get yourself a Jedi.

Every marketing tactic I wanted my employer to pursue has now happened or will be this year because they hired an amazing leader who saw the value in content, sharing our activity and knowledge, and events/webinars. This woman gets things DONE. She heard my requests (or saw the gap herself) for more support for social media, tracking, and collaboration with sales, and they hired a director who is instituting a strategy to integrate everything mentioned above.

Tangent: Please know that I have never desired to be middle management and, thus, never pursue such opportunities. I either want all the responsibility (and freedom of choice) as a solopreneur or minimal responsibility as a happy employee. This is why I stay low and continue to do great work.

This company has returned to nearly 100% after losing over 50% of billable income when everyone was cutting costs in March and April. Our team is amazing, but someone is doing that outreach to drive our growth – our Jedi.

I strongly encourage small business owners to find a Jedi in marketing.
